掌握 MySQL 和 HBase 数据备份的秘诀
数据备份对于 MySQL 和 HBase 来说至关重要,在当今数字化时代,数据就是企业和个人的宝贵资产,确保数据的安全性和可恢复性是必不可少的工作。
MySQL 和 HBase 是两种常见的数据库管理系统,它们在不同的应用场景中发挥着重要作用,要有效地备份这两种数据库中的数据,需要掌握一定的技巧和方法。

备份 MySQL 数据可以采用多种方式,物理备份是直接复制数据库的相关文件,包括数据文件、日志文件等,这种备份方式速度较快,但需要停止数据库服务,可能会对业务造成一定影响,逻辑备份则是通过导出数据库中的数据为 SQL 语句或其他格式的文件,如 CSV 等,它的优点是可以在数据库运行时进行,但备份和恢复的时间可能较长。
对于 HBase 数据备份,通常可以使用 HBase 的内置工具或者第三方工具来实现,HBase 的内置工具如 Export 和 Snapshot 功能,能够帮助用户快速备份和恢复数据,Export 功能将表数据导出为 HFile 格式,而 Snapshot 则创建表的即时快照,以便后续恢复使用。

在进行数据备份时,还需要考虑备份的频率、存储位置以及备份数据的验证等方面,合理的备份频率可以根据数据的更新频率和重要程度来确定,存储位置应选择安全可靠的介质,并且要定期检查存储介质的可用性,对备份数据进行定期验证,确保其可恢复性和完整性也是非常重要的。
无论是 MySQL 还是 HBase,数据备份都是保障数据安全的重要措施,只有熟练掌握各种备份方法,并结合实际情况进行合理的配置和管理,才能有效地保护数据资产,避免因数据丢失而带来的损失。
参考来源:相关数据库技术文档和实践经验总结。